North America Nuclear Imaging Market Analysis

The North America Nuclear Imaging Market size is estimated at USD 3.91 billion in 2025, and is expected to reach USD 4.72 billion by 2030, at a CAGR of 3.83% during the forecast period (2025-2030).

  • The market is expected to grow with technological advancements, increasing diagnostic applications in various diseases, such as cancer and cardiovascular diseases, and increasing government support. The prevalence of chronic diseases is on the rise in the North American region, which is expected to create more demand for nuclear imaging. For instance, according to data published by the Canadian Cancer Society in May 2022, it was estimated that over 30,000 individuals in Canada would be diagnosed with lung and bronchus cancer. This represented an increase of 13% in the cases of lung and bronchus cancer from 2021 to 2022. It was also estimated that over 20,700 lives would be claimed by the disease in 2022. 
  • The high prevalence of such chronic diseases has created a huge demand for nuclear imaging diagnosis for the management of diseases in the region. For instance, data published in the Canadian Medical Imaging Inventory Service Report in January 2022 mentioned that demand for PET-CT services has been rising in Canada. The report stated that there is a need for more PET systems. It was mentioned that in Canada, there were 1.5 PET units per million population. The country ranked 16th out of 25 in the list of the volume of PET-CT exams, with over 3.3 scans per 1,000 population. Thus, the vast patient base and the increasing demand for nuclear imaging are expected to create more growth opportunities in the North American region.
  • The strategic activities by the market players such as introduction of advanced equipment in market is expected boost the market growth over the forecast period. For instance, in November 2023, Positron Corporation has secured a significant new customer in Pennsylvania's cardiovascular sector. The client will be leveraging Positron's cutting-edge Attrius PET System and accompanying services. The installation of the Attrius system is scheduled to align with the facility's radiopharmaceutical timeline.
  • Additionally, in October 2022, GE Healthcare launched its Omni Legend, which is a first-of-its-kind all-digital PET-CT system. The system is equipped with cutting-edge system features such as digital BGO (dBGO) detector material, and it offers high efficiency and improved diagnostics for precision medicines. Similarly, in November 2023, IONETIX, a Cardiac PET services and isotope manufacturing company expanded its partnership with the Center for Imaging and Research of America (CIRA) in Sarasota, United States. Under the partnership, IONETIX launched the new PET/CT imaging facility, which utilizes N-13 Ammonia, which is manufactured by IONETIX itself.
  • Therefore, owing to the aforementioned factors, the studied market is anticipated to witness growth over the analysis period. However, the regulatory issues and lack of reimbursement are likely to impede market growth.

North America Nuclear Imaging Market News

  • May 2024: Blue Earth Diagnostics, a Bracco company, has inked a non-exclusive data-sharing pact with Siemens Healthineers. The agreement covers the sharing of anonymized clinical data and images of POSLUMA® (previously 18F-rhPSMA-7.3) injection from Blue Earth Diagnostics' Phase 3 LIGHTHOUSE trial, focusing on newly diagnosed prostate cancer.
  • March 2023: Positron Corporation signed a Clinical Study/Research Agreement with the Ochsner Clinic Foundation and Dr. Bober, Director of Molecular Imaging and Nuclear Cardiology at Ochsner Health. Under the agreement, the company and the organizations would carry out clinical studies of its new PET-CT imaging device, the Affinity PET-CT 4D.

North America Nuclear Imaging Industry Segmentation

Nuclear medicine imaging procedures are non-invasive, apart from intravenous injections, and are usually painless medical tests that help physicians diagnose and evaluate medical conditions. These imaging scans use radioactive materials called radiopharmaceuticals or radiotracers. These radiopharmaceuticals are used in diagnosis and therapeutics. They are small substances that contain a radioactive substance that is used in the treatment of cancer and cardiac and neurological disorders.
